A capsule can be a device solid dosage form in which the drug factors are enclosed in a soluble shell. Capsules assistance to mask the disagreeable taste of its contents along with the drug has minimal interaction Together with the excipients. Capsules are classified into two forms: Hard-shelled capsules, that are used to encapsulate dry, powdered parts; tender-shelled capsules, principally employed for hydrophobic drugs and oily Lively substances which might be suspended or dissolved in oil. Lozenges are chewable stable unit dosage forms, where the drug is loaded inside of a caramel base created up of sugar and gum; the latter offers cohesiveness and energy on the lozenge and allows slow release on the drug.

Summary The drug delivery system enables the release of the Energetic pharmaceutical ingredient to attain a wanted therapeutic reaction. Conventional drug delivery systems (tablets, capsules, syrups, ointments, etc.) experience bad bioavailability and fluctuations in plasma drug degree and are not able to attain sustained release. With out an successful delivery mechanism, The complete therapeutic process may be rendered useless. Also, the drug has to be sent in a specified controlled charge and in the focus on web page as exactly as you possibly can to obtain greatest efficacy and security. Controlled drug delivery systems are developed to beat the issues connected with regular drug get more info delivery. There was a tremendous evolution in controlled drug delivery systems from your past two decades ranging from macro scale and nano scale to smart focused delivery.
